This sort of thing can become really complicated, depending on the crew who attend.

Make sure the rules are laid down hard and fast first. Its so much better up front than complaining about it later (and someone will anyway).

things you'll need to cover:

Amount of lasers/drones (do people get paid a percentage based on number of laser/type?)

Haulage, now no offense to anyone... but... can you trust the haulers? I remember when I was in TTI I got ripped off by a hauler who, I think, simply left the game soon after (subscription probably ran out - I hope anyway).

If you can wangle some help from some of the bigger corps, perhaps turn it into a semi-recruitment drive, then you should be able to get some nice reliable haulage. I'm sure one of the big-boys wouldn't mind giving up an indy pilot or two for the chance of recruiting more workers.

I wouldn't expect any help from the GM's, they've said before that if you can't run a player-run event by yourselves then kinda tough.
However, DO inform them where you are going to be mining. Hopefully they can increase processing power on that node

Thanks for the thoughts Lomex. I'm not expecting to many new players to take up the offer of this first group mining night. But even if I just get two or three interested, then hopefully things will spread by word of mouth for future mining nights.
My overall plan was to keep things as simple as possible, and simply split things equally amongst everybody. As I'm aiming this at new players I don't expect uber mining ships, at best something like the odd mining torm, or other race equivalents.
I had in mind running it for upto three hours, with each player taking part getting one equal share for each hour taking part. So somebody there for the full three hours will get three shares, but somebody who comes in for just an hour just gets a single share.
Amane is a level 0.5 system so we only need a couple of frigates running gun cover, and perhaps a single Indy hauling, though that can be changed if needed.
As you mentioned, the real problem is showing players that it is an honest opperation. But I've decided that all I can do is run this, see who turns up, and if they go off happy with the results at the end of the night, then I hope that they will put the word around for future events.
